What Is an Airflow Dryer?

An airflow dryer is a moisture removal system that uses controlled air circulation to dry materials in laboratory and industrial environments.
It ensures consistent drying conditions for testing and processing.

How Airflow Dryer NAFD-100 Works

  • Samples are placed inside the drying chamber

  • Controlled airflow is circulated across materials

  • Air may be heated or ambient

  • Moisture evaporates from surfaces

  • Continuous airflow removes released moisture

Airflow Dryer vs Vacuum Oven vs Hot Air Oven

1.Airflow Dryer vs Vacuum Oven
   Airflow dryers use air circulation; vacuum ovens use low pressure.

2.Airflow Dryer vs Hot Air Oven
   Airflow dryers ensure uniform airflow; hot air ovens use static heated air.

Technical Specifications

Parameter

Specification

Airflow Type

Forced airflow

Temperature Range

Ambient to 100°C

Drying Capacity

Batch drying

Control System

Digital

Construction

SS / Powder-coated steel

Power Supply

220V AC
